The excitement of the WNBA All-Star Weekend is palpable, but this year, fans are disheartened as two star players, Caitlin Clark and Satou Sabally, have been forced to withdraw due to injuries.

Caitlin Clark's Groin Injury

Caitlin Clark

Fever star Caitlin Clark, a fan favorite and standout player, announced her withdrawal from the All-Star festivities due to a groin injury. Clark has been a pivotal player this season, and her absence will certainly be felt on the court. Fans were looking forward to her dazzling performance, but health must come first.

Satou Sabally's Decision

Satou Sabally

Similarly, Mercury star Satou Sabally has also confirmed she will not be participating in the WNBA All-Star Game. This announcement comes as a blow for fans who were eager to see her play alongside other league stars. Sabally's strong performances this season have made her a key player for spectators to watch.
